If you are thinking about selling your home, the biggest question is not just when to sell. It is how your home will be positioned in the market so it stands out, attracts the right buyers, and ultimately sells for the strongest possible price.

In today’s real estate market, simply putting a home on the MLS is not enough. Buyers are more informed, more selective, and have access to more options than ever before. The difference between a home that sits and a home that sells comes down to strategy, exposure, and execution.

Before your home ever hits the market, we focus on positioning. This includes pricing strategy backed by real time data, preparation guidance, and in many cases, virtual staging to help buyers clearly see the potential of the space. First impressions matter, and most buyers will see your home online before they ever step inside.

From there, we build a full scale marketing plan designed to maximize exposure. Professional photography and luxury video are standard, not optional. Your home is showcased through high quality visuals that are built to perform across digital platforms, social media, and search.

We also leverage advanced listing syndication, ensuring your property is distributed across hundreds of real estate websites and platforms where buyers are actively searching.
